Nice review. I think one big advantage of recording in 4K and rendering to 1080p is being able to crop shots and it still be in full res where if you do that on a 1080p source your quality of your crop shots really go down.

Just wanted to add about shooting in 4K...I use it to have a bigger canvas to work with in post for my videos. Use Ken Burns to zoom in and out and do pans. It also means that if your framing was not perfect, you can crop out unwanted stuff. I love 4K as a shooting/editing format. Then I also upload in 1080p.

If you can come up with the dosh for it, I'd recommend the Panasonic 12-35mm/f2.8 II zoom. I'd get the second generation as it's compatible with Panasonic's dual image stabilization system. It has amazing image quality, a fixed maximum aperture, and a very usable zoom range. It's a very popular lens among GH5 videographers for a reason. It's my go to zoom and I don't even do video. You mentioned a possible interesst in wide angle video so if you can live with a fixed focal length, check out the Laowa 7.5mm/f2.0. It's all manual (welcome to focus peaking) and produces a rectilinear image (straight lines, not a fisheye.) It's also very affordable for the quality of both the lens build and the image. Year late to the club here, but the G80 is the UK variant with a 30 minute video recording limit to prevent the camera from being considered a video recorder which would incur an additional tax. The G85 is the WW variant with no recording limit.
